Let’s face it – the solar industry is booming faster than a photovoltaic panel on a sunny day. But here’s the shocker: not all solar companies are created equal. In 2023 alone, the Solar Energy Industries Association reported a 35% increase in residential installations, but also a 20% uptick in consumer complaints about shady operators. That’s like buying a Tesla and getting a golf cart instead!
Imagine this: You’re at a dinner party when your neighbor brags about their new solar array. “Got it for $5k!” they say. Two months later, their roof leaks and the panels produce less energy than a hamster wheel. Moral of the story? Going solar without proper research is like Tinder-swiping your home’s energy future.
